当前位置:首页 / EXCEL

Excel表格整体修改字母?如何批量更改?

作者:佚名|分类:EXCEL|浏览:163|发布时间:2025-04-12 09:23:57

Excel表格整体修改字母?如何批量更改?

导语:

在处理Excel表格时,我们经常会遇到需要整体修改字母的情况,比如将所有字母改为大写或小写,或者将特定的字母序列替换为其他字母。以下将详细介绍如何在Excel中批量更改字母,并提供一些实用的技巧。

一、Excel表格整体修改字母的方法

1. 使用“查找和替换”功能

这是最简单也是最常用的方法。以下是具体步骤:

(1)选中需要修改的单元格区域。

(2)点击“开始”选项卡下的“查找和替换”按钮。

(3)在弹出的“查找和替换”对话框中,选择“替换”选项卡。

(4)在“查找内容”框中输入需要替换的字母。

(5)在“替换为”框中输入新的字母。

(6)点击“全部替换”按钮,即可完成批量更改。

2. 使用公式

如果你需要将所有字母改为大写或小写,可以使用以下公式:

将所有字母改为大写:=UPPER(A1)

将所有字母改为小写:=LOWER(A1)

其中,A1是你要修改的单元格。

3. 使用VBA宏

如果你需要更复杂的字母修改操作,可以使用VBA宏来实现。以下是VBA宏的示例代码:

```vba

Sub ChangeLetters()

Dim cell As Range

Dim strText As String

For Each cell In Selection

strText = cell.Text

cell.Text = Replace(strText, "原字母", "新字母")

Next cell

End Sub

```

在这个示例中,你需要将“原字母”和“新字母”替换为你需要替换的字母。

二、如何批量更改字母的技巧

1. 使用快捷键

在“查找和替换”对话框中,按下“Ctrl+H”键可以快速打开该对话框。

2. 使用通配符

在“查找内容”框中,可以使用通配符来匹配多个字母。例如,如果你想替换所有以“a”开头的字母,可以在“查找内容”框中输入“a*”。

3. 使用“替换为”框中的格式

在“替换为”框中,你可以使用格式按钮来设置新的字母格式,如加粗、斜体等。

三、相关问答

1. 问题:如何将Excel表格中所有字母改为大写?

回答: 可以使用“查找和替换”功能,在“查找内容”框中留空,在“替换为”框中输入`=UPPER(A1)`,然后点击“全部替换”按钮。

2. 问题:如何将Excel表格中所有字母改为小写?

回答: 同样使用“查找和替换”功能,在“查找内容”框中留空,在“替换为”框中输入`=LOWER(A1)`,然后点击“全部替换”按钮。

3. 问题:如何使用VBA宏批量替换字母?

回答: 在Excel中按下“Alt+F11”键打开VBA编辑器,插入一个新模块,然后复制并粘贴上述VBA宏代码,最后运行该宏即可。

4. 问题:如何使用通配符进行查找和替换?

回答: 在“查找内容”框中,可以使用“*”代表任意数量的字符,“?”代表任意单个字符。例如,“a*”可以匹配所有以“a”开头的单词。

总结:

通过以上方法,你可以轻松地在Excel表格中批量更改字母。掌握这些技巧,将大大提高你的工作效率。